[trunk] Requires CMake 2.8.2 at least
authorMathieu Malaterre <mathieu.malaterre@gmail.com>
Mon, 1 Oct 2012 14:18:20 +0000 (14:18 +0000)
committerMathieu Malaterre <mathieu.malaterre@gmail.com>
Mon, 1 Oct 2012 14:18:20 +0000 (14:18 +0000)
CMakeLists.txt
cmake/OpenJPEGCPack.cmake

index dfa4bebaed0c4d8fff59c88602abce6ca8a4c8c2..ea71f0d97a3b31e0775272d5a73892d19e71aa95 100644 (file)
@@ -7,7 +7,7 @@
 # For this purpose you can define a CMake var: OPENJPEG_NAMESPACE to whatever you like
 # e.g.:
 # set(OPENJPEG_NAMESPACE "GDCMOPENJPEG")
-cmake_minimum_required(VERSION 2.6)
+cmake_minimum_required(VERSION 2.8.2)
 
 if(COMMAND CMAKE_POLICY)
   cmake_policy(SET CMP0003 NEW)
index 1a40ff17b1c99b283ccb1790bf42f190bd472811..a6e9a866e2b80cbcb84ee38cb5fd08f96416cac0 100644 (file)
@@ -60,11 +60,13 @@ if(EXISTS "${CMAKE_ROOT}/Modules/CPack.cmake")
   endif()
 
   set(CPACK_BUNDLE_NAME "OpenJPEG ${CPACK_PACKAGE_VERSION_MAJOR}.${CPACK_PACKAGE_VERSION_MINOR}")
-  configure_file(${CMAKE_ROOT}/Templates/AppleInfo.plist
-    ${CMAKE_CURRENT_BINARY_DIR}/opj.plist)
-  set(CPACK_BUNDLE_PLIST
-    ${CMAKE_CURRENT_BINARY_DIR}/opj.plist)
-  #include(BundleUtilities)
+  if(APPLE)
+    configure_file(${CMAKE_ROOT}/Templates/AppleInfo.plist
+      ${CMAKE_CURRENT_BINARY_DIR}/opj.plist)
+    set(CPACK_BUNDLE_PLIST
+      ${CMAKE_CURRENT_BINARY_DIR}/opj.plist)
+    #include(BundleUtilities)
+  endif()
 
   include(CPack)
 endiF(EXISTS "${CMAKE_ROOT}/Modules/CPack.cmake")